Quantifying Heteromer Partitioning Reveals Inflammation‐Dependent Redistribution of Microglial Adenosine A2A and Cannabinoid CB2 Receptors

open access: yesGlia, Volume 74, Issue 9, September 2026.
Proinflammatory activation reorganizes microglial A2A and CB2 receptors, promoting their incorporation into stable heteromers and blocking agonist‐induced redistribution. The results reveal those heteromers as potential therapeutic targets in inflammatory contexts.

Proteo‐Metabolomic Profiling of PMM2‐CDG Reveals Dysregulation of Retinoic Acid Synthesis, Myo‐Inositol, and the Hexosamine Pathway

open access: yesJournal of Inherited Metabolic Disease, Volume 49, Issue 5, September 2026.
ABSTRACT Phosphomannomutase deficiency (PMM2‐CDG), the most common congenital disorder of glycosylation (CDG), is characterized by multisystem involvement and a lack of disease‐modifying therapies. While previous transcriptomic studies have uncovered disrupted cellular pathways, the functional consequences of these alterations remain poorly understood.
